Analysis
The most recent figure for particle board — production in Slovenia is 0 m3, measured in 2024. That is the lowest value across all 30 years on record.
The figure is down 100.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, particle board — production in Slovenia peaked at 458,160 m3 in 2002 and was at its lowest, 0 m3, in 2016.
Slovenia ranks 83rd of 117 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 273,000 m3 | 246,000 m3 | 351,000 m3 | 5 |
| 2000s | 240,687 m3 | 117,489 m3 | 458,160 m3 | 10 |
| 2010s | 53,000 m3 | 0 m3 | 130,000 m3 | 10 |
| 2020s | 0 m3 | 0 m3 | 0 m3 | 5 |

About this data
The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
